Which tiers suit Trading & Financial Application Operators
Including the ones that do not, and why — that is usually the more useful half.
| Infrastructure | Verdict | Why |
|---|---|---|
| Shared Hosting Managed space on a shared server | Not this one | Persistent connections and custom ports are exactly what a shared platform does not permit. |
| VPS Flexible virtual infrastructure with full root access | Workable | Enough for a small server or a test instance, though a noisy neighbour shows up immediately as jitter. |
| VDS Virtual server with resources pinned to you alone | Recommended | Pinned cores are what keep tick rate and call quality steady; on a contended instance they are not. |
| Dedicated Server An entire physical server, configured to your specification | Recommended | Single-tenant hardware removes the last source of variance, which is what these workloads are judged on. |
| Bare Metal Physical compute for sustained, demanding workloads | Workable | For operators running many instances at once on hardware they control. |

Trading & Financial Applications in Madison, business by business
These are not the same workload. Sized at the large band, here is what each one actually needs.
| Business | Build | Tier | What decides it |
|---|---|---|---|
| Trading Platforms | 16 vCPU · 196 GB · 700 GB | Dedicated Server | Judged on consistency rather than throughput: a predictable few milliseconds beats a fast average with a slow... |
| Algorithmic Trading | 28 vCPU · 448 GB · 4000 GB | Bare Metal | Backtesting is heavy batch compute over years of tick data, while live execution wants an uncontended core doi... |
| Forex Brokers | 16 vCPU · 196 GB · 800 GB | Dedicated Server | The market never closes during the week, so there is no maintenance window in the ordinary sense. |
| Crypto Exchanges | 20 vCPU · 320 GB · 4000 GB | Bare Metal | Twenty-four hours a day with no weekend, and a node that has to stay in sync with a chain that never pauses. |
| Market Data Providers | 20 vCPU · 320 GB · 4000 GB | Bare Metal | Ingest never stops and the archive never shrinks — this is a storage and throughput problem before anything el... |
| Investment Firms | 16 vCPU · 196 GB · 900 GB | Dedicated Server | Reporting periods drive the load, and investor statements are a deadline with regulatory weight behind it. |
